JICA Collaborating With Kedah In Halal Food Production

By Ima Aimi Nadia Ibrahim ALOR SETAR (Kedah, Malaysia), Feb 25 (Bernama) -- Japan International Cooperation Agency (JICA), in collaboration with the Kedah government, plans to produce Japanese halal food products for the Malaysian market. JICA has identified Gurun-based Ambang Dorongan Sdn Bhd for the production of 'mochi', a Japanese confectionary made from pounded pasty rice and molded into shape, to get the venture started. Kedah Women Development, Welfare, Agriculture, Agro-based and Entrepreneur Development Committee chairman Suraya Yaakob said the venture was concluded during JICA's visit to Ambang Dorongan's manufacturing facilities Tuesday. "During the visit, JICA officials witnessed how 'mochi' was being produced using local ingredients. They sampled the traditional Japanese food and were satisfied with its quality," she told Bernama here Tuesday. Suraya said the collaboration between JICA and Ambang Dorongan would pave the way for halal food products from Kedah to enter overseas market. "JICA has shown keen interest in halal food production and plans to set up a halal park like that of Sungai Petani in Hokkaido. We are willing to share our knowledge on the halal food industry with them for mutual benefits," she said. JICA small and medium enterprise overseas adviser Shinichi Tsuboi said JICA ventured not only in halal food but also in continental food production. He said JICA's collaboration with Kedah in halal food production was in preparation for the Tokyo 2020 Olympics to cater to the needs of Muslim athletes and visitors. -- BERNAMA
